Munich City Centre

Known for its fantastic breweries and popular shops, there's plenty to explore in Munich City Centre. Check out top attractions like Marienplatz and Theresienwiese, and jump on the metro at Lenbachplatz Tram Stop or Karlsplatz (Stachus) Station to see more of the city.

Ludwigsvorstadt-Kliniken

Travellers love Ludwigsvorstadt-Kliniken for its fantastic nightlife, and you can see more of Munich by jumping on the metro at Sendlinger Gate U-Bahn or Munich Central Station Tram Stop. You might spend time checking out top sights like Landwehrstrasse and German Theater.

Altstadt-Lehel

Marienplatz and Kaufingerstrasse are top sights in Altstadt-Lehel, and you should be sure to explore the popular shops. Hop aboard the metro at Lenbachplatz Tram Stop or Karlsplatz (Stachus) Station to see more sights in the area.

Nuremberg Old Town

Historical sites, museums and shopping highlight some notable features of Nuremberg Old Town. Make a stop by Nuremberg Christmas Market or Main Market Square while you're visiting, and jump aboard the metro at Lawrence Church U-Bahn or White Tower U-Bahn to get around town.

Graggenau

Noted for its museums and historical sites, there's plenty to explore in Graggenau. Top attractions like Marienplatz and National Theater are major draws, and you can hop on the metro at Nationaltheater Tram Stop or Kammerspiele Tram Stop to see more of the city.

Best time to go to Bavaria

The best time to visit Bavaria is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

Bavaria Essential Information

Language
German
Currency
Euros
Local Welcome
Guten TagServus
Local Goodbye
Tschüss
Closest Airport
Franz Josef Strauss Intl. Airport (MUC)
Top Sights
Olympic Park, Theresienwiese and Erding Thermal Spa
